Project accounting focuses on the financial transactions related to managing a project including costs, billing and revenue. Professionals such as project managers and accountants use this method to integrate key financial tasks on a project-by-project basis and report their progress and success to management. This involves outlining costs for materials, labor, and overhead while forecasting income based on client agreements or deliverables. For instance, an IT company developing a custom app might allocate a $200,000 budget while expecting $300,000 in revenue, ensuring clear financial targets from the outset. The period of time that is covered by the income statement (and other financial statements) is called the accounting period. In reality, companies often use more complicated “multiple-step” income statements, where key expenses are separated into groups or categories. In multiple-step income statements, tax is shown on its own line, completely separate from all other business expenses. 📖 Project accounting or project financial management is directly related to the management of the budget constraint. The access to real-time information facilitates tracking costs and revenues and comparing them with how the project’s progressing. Project cost or project budget is where project accounting fits in, with a focus on the financial management processes. Project financial reporting is concerned with disclosing financial information to different stakeholders about the true financial position and performance of a project over a given period of time.
